Output 80f31551364b5cd643b1d27b863f7e0aa2c1029c14adf84a86f055ce2919034d:1

value
41491271
script pubkey
OP_0 OP_PUSHBYTES_20 bbe3def8682deb2e08558589fddd4c202c6e68ca
address
ltc1qh03aa7rg9h4juzz4skylmh2vyqkxu6x2zta84t
transaction
80f31551364b5cd643b1d27b863f7e0aa2c1029c14adf84a86f055ce2919034d
spent
true